/** @type {import('tailwindcss').Config} */ module.exports = { darkMode: 'class', content: [ './src/**/*.{ts,html,ejs}', './src/dashboard/**/*.{html,js}', ], theme: { extend: { fontFamily: { mono: ['JetBrains Mono', 'SF Mono', 'Fira Code', 'ui-monospace', 'monospace'], sans: ['Inter', 'system-ui', '-apple-system', 'sans-serif'], }, colors: { brand: '#3b82f6', surface: { DEFAULT: 'rgba(17, 17, 17, 0.8)', hover: 'rgba(24, 24, 27, 0.9)', solid: '#111111', }, 'border-subtle': 'rgba(38, 38, 44, 0.6)', 'border-strong': 'rgba(55, 55, 64, 0.8)', }, boxShadow: { 'glow-sm': '0 0 20px rgba(59, 130, 246, 0.06)', 'glow-md': '0 0 40px rgba(59, 130, 246, 0.1)', 'glow-green': '0 0 12px rgba(34, 197, 94, 0.3)', 'glow-red': '0 0 12px rgba(239, 68, 68, 0.3)', 'card': '0 1px 3px rgba(0, 0, 0, 0.3), 0 1px 2px rgba(0, 0, 0, 0.2)', 'card-hover': '0 4px 12px rgba(0, 0, 0, 0.4), 0 0 20px rgba(59, 130, 246, 0.04)', }, }, }, plugins: [], }